Prognostic factors for duration of sick leave due to low back pain related to characteristics of current episode
Prognostic factor | Pooled ES (95% CI) | + adjusted for quality | + adjusted for non-report of ES |
---|---|---|---|
–, pooling not possible; ES, effect size. | |||
History of LBP24–26,33–36 | 1.08 (0.87 to 1.34) | 1.05 (0.84 to 1.30) | 0.89 (0.70 to 1.12) |
Disability24–26,33–36 | 2.39 (1.33 to 4.29) | 2.40 (1.34 to 4.31) | – |
Pain intensity24,33–36 | 1.10 (1.01 to 1.20) | 1.10 (1.01 to 1.20) | 1.10 (1.01 to 1.20) |
Physical examination29,34 | 1.10 (1.03 to 1.18) | – | 1.10 (1.01 to 1.20) |
Radiating pain20,21,23,24,29–32,34–36 | 2.52 (1.76 to 3.63) | 2.49 (1.42 to 4.36) | 2.08 (1.48 to 2.92) |
Accident type (ref: overexposure) | – | – | |
Impact | 1.00 (0.77 to 1.31) | ||
Fall same level | 1.08 (0.84 to 1.39) | ||
Fall from elevation27,28 | 1.16 (0.90 to 1.51) | ||
Work related injury33 | 0.36 (0.15 to 0.87) | – | – |
